golang: crypto/tls: lack of a limit on buffered post-handshake
A flaw was found in Golang. QUIC connections do not set an upper bound on the amount of data buffered when reading post-handshake messages, allowing a malicious QUIC connection to cause unbounded memory growth. With the fix, connections now consistently reject messages larger than 65KiB in size...

Candid infinite decoding loop through specially crafted payload
Impact The Candid library causes a Denial of Service while parsing a specially crafted payload with empty data type. For example, if the payload is record ; empty and the canister interface expects record then the rust candid decoder treats empty as an extra field required by the type. The proble...

Reentrancy in mint function allows minting above the limit allowed per address / allowlisted address
Lines of code Vulnerability details Impact The mint function in NextGenCore.sol doesn't follow the checks-effects-interactions pattern and can be reentered through the onERC721Received function, if the receiver is a contract. The state variables written after the call are...

openssl: Possible DoS translating ASN.1 object identifiers
A flaw was found in OpenSSL resulting in a possible denial of service while translating ASN.1 object identifiers. Applications that use OBJobj2txt directly, or use any of the OpenSSL subsystems OCSP, PKCS7/SMIME, CMS, CMP/CRMF or TS with no message size limit may experience long delays when...
